GOAL: Develop and experimentally validate novel multi-AUV coverage algorithms that can handle currents and faults in the missions.

During REP(MUS)19 exercise, the second UPORTO TNA access took place at UPORTO Atlantic Testbed from the 16th to the 27th of September, in PAN Tróia (Portugal).  
The aim of the project AUVCover, carried out by the Indraprastha Institute of Information Technology Delhi, was multi-robot coverage algorithms. The focus being the development of a fault tolerant multi-robot area coverage algorithm, which takes the current information into account (adaptive orientation), while performing sonar imaging of the desired objects in the seabed.
For this, access to 3 LAUVs equipped with sidescan sonars was necessary. This TNA was reallocated from UPORTO-Local to UPORTO Atlantic installation since it provides more currents and thus constitutes a better test site for the end-user purposes.

However, the goals weren’t completely fulfilled, and more sets of field trials were ran this time in the UPORTO-Local installation, in December.
